CVE-2026-0267
MEDIUMGlobalProtect App: Information Exposure Vulnerability on macOS
Title source: cnaDescription
An information exposure vulnerability in the Palo Alto Networks GlobalProtect app on macOS enables a local user to learn the configured passcodes for disabling, disconnecting, or uninstalling the GlobalProtect app. After the passcode is known, the user can perform these actions even if the GlobalProtect app configuration would not normally permit them to do so.
